Purpose:
The Illinois Space Grant Consortium (ISGC) awards graduate fellowships to support outstanding graduate students pursuing aerospace, astrophysics, astronomy, cosmology, Earth system science and other interdisciplinary space-related science, engineering, or mathematics fields.
Awards:
Up to (7) $10,000 fellowships will be awarded for the 2020-2021 academic year. Funding will be released incumbent upon authorization of funds by NASA.
Requirements:
- U.S. citizen
- Full-time current enrollment at an ISGC institution
- Minimum 3.0/4.0 GPA
- Good academic record
- Research or design experience in a field related to astronomy, aerospace, cosmology, astrophysics, or Earth science
- Completed application (see below)
- All application materials must be submitted by February 9, 2020, 11:59 PM.
Selection Criteria:
Award winners will be chosen based on student qualifications, scientific and educational relevance of the proposed activity, faculty member’s expressed commitment to the project, and the application. Women, under-represented minorities, and persons with disabilities are strongly encouraged to apply.
